With temps in the high 90's and low 100's, any jacket is going to make you feel hotter when you put it on; this one has very effective airflow once you are moving. It is comfortable, fits a bit on the snug side (that I prefer), is well made of quality materials, and looks good. The protective inserts fit me in the right places, and I bought the optional back protector that has more heft than the one that it comes with. Not sure about the durability since I have had it only a short time.

It is cool at speed, but hot in traffic like others. I bought this because it had decent level of protection for a textile jacket lighter than my perforated leather jacket. Wanted silver color, but my size was unavailable. Sizing seemed slightly big. I returned the larger size. Waist adjustment inadequate for thinner people, but tolerable. Recommend you buy the back armor with it - bubble wrap is better than what is in it. Shoulder/elbow armor typical for 150-300 price range.

Sizing was a concern and I watched the videos on line (Revzilla) and have a catalogue. I'm a men’s 42 and the charts suggest a 54 - which fits fine. Jacket is cool in HOT summer and a tad chilly now September - however there is room underneath for a fleece vest or some layering. I'd like to see a RHS inner pocket but otherwise it’s a great, stylish jacket

Breaths very well and flows plenty of air. One of the few jackets out there that is not all black which helps to keep you cooler during the summer. The fitment seems to run a couple sizes too big. After using the sizing chart, I had to return the first and get a size smaller. I stayed with the second one I got, though I could have gone with another size smaller if I wanted a better fit.
